Core Transaction: Procure to Pay
Purchase Order → Payment
Once a Purchase Order is issued, the classic Procure to Pay cycle begins. This phase covers from sending the PO to the vendor, through goods or service receipt, invoice matching, and final payment execution.
The critical step is the three-way match: making sure the Purchase Order, the Goods Receipt, and the Vendor Invoice all line up. VeroTX's AI agents automate the entire matching process, flagging exceptions for human review while letting clean matches flow through.
VeroCortex keeps a close eye on every open PO for receipt confirmations, follows up on outstanding deliveries, and makes sure invoices are processed within agreed payment terms.

Vendor Bill Management: Bill to Pay
Vendor Bill → Payment
Not every vendor payment starts with a formal Purchase Order. Utility invoices, consulting retainers, recurring SaaS subscriptions, and ad hoc service bills arrive directly from vendors. This is the Bill to Pay cycle.
VeroTX's Bill to Pay phase handles vendor-initiated billing end-to-end. Invoices arriving via email, EDI, or supplier portal are automatically captured, parsed, and extracted by AI. VeroCortex then classifies the spend, assigns GL codes, identifies the right approver, and moves the bill through a streamlined approval workflow.
Veroli keeps the experience simple for approvers. They get a clear, concise bill summary right in their chat interface and can approve, query, or dispute with a single interaction.

The Full Procurement Cycle: Source to Pay (S2P)
Business Need → Payment (End-to-End)
Source to Pay (S2P) is the complete, end-to-end view of the procurement lifecycle. It starts the moment a sourcing need or intake request is identified and runs all the way through to final payment. S2P is the frame that makes VeroTX unique.
This matters because procurement inefficiency rarely lives in one place. A sourcing event that takes weeks delays the PR. A PO with missing fields causes an invoice mismatch. Slow approvals create compounding delays. When Veroli and VeroCortex operate across the full lifecycle with shared context, the entire chain speeds up together.
The result is faster cycle times, stronger policy compliance, reduced tail spend, better vendor relationships, and a complete auditable record from first sourcing contact to final payment.
